pseudo-ergonomics. The basic idea is you're not going to use the 10 key very much so you're hands will almost always be resting on the left side of your computer where the main part of your keyboard is. from that thought pattern the trackpad is directly below the center of the keyboard so the hands only have to move strait down to access it. Also if you put a trackpoint on the keyboard its left and right buttons would be directly above the left mounted trackpad. that is why it is located there.
